Principal Data & AI Platforms Architect is responsible for overseeing architecture, strategy and operations for the Analytics & AI teams. High level job duties include:

Data & AI Platforms Architecture

  • Lead the transformation of data operations by embedding AI-driven automation, reducing manual intervention, and enhancing operational efficiency.

  • Develop the technical vision for data and AI platforms, including infrastructure, tools, and processes for agentic AI systems

  • Evaluate and recommend appropriate technologies for data management, analytics, machine learning operations, and AI model deployment

  • Drive standardization and reuse by identifying and socializing best-in-class technologies and methodologies and avoid technology sprawl by leading subject area reviews in Architecture Review Board (ARB) meetings

Transformation & Innovation:

  • Demonstrate a strong focus on innovation by constantly identifying and experimenting with data technologies that push the boundaries of what's possible, ensuring the organization remains at the forefront of digital transformation.

  • Champion the development of frictionless, Data and AI platforms and ecosystems

Strategic Oversight & Stakeholder Management:

  • Build and maintain strong relationships with stakeholders across business units to ensure successful adoption and optimization of data products and cloud services.

  • Monitor industry trends, emerging technologies, and best practices to drive the culture of innovation and continuous improvement

Team Leadership & Development:

  • Lead, mentor, and develop a high-performing team of data professionals, and cloud specialists.

  • Foster a culture of collaboration, accountability, and excellence within the team, driving continuous learning and improvement.

Basic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ree in computer science, electrical engineering, electronics engineering, mathematics, statistics, or information systems.

  • 8+ years of professional experience

  • Experience in cloud technologies: AWS (Redshift, S3, RDS, DynamoDB, Neptune), or Azure (Synapse, Data Lake, Databricks, CosmosDB), or GCP (BigQuery, Bigtable, CloudSQL, Spanner, Firebase)

  • Experience with data technologies: SQL, NoSQL, Data Warehousing, Data Lakes, and Data Lakehouse architectures with knowledge of Big Data technologies: Hadoop ecosystem, Spark or Kafka

  • Programming skills in Python or Java, with experience in data processing libraries

  • Experience designing and implementing big data solutions and AI/ML platforms such as MLflow, Kubeflow, SageMaker, or Azure ML

  • Experience with machine learning operations (MLOps) and AI model deployment

  • Experience with Agentic AI systems and platforms, including Agent Orchestration frameworks

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Strong strategic, analytical, and problem-solving skills, with the ability to make data-driven decisions.

  • Exceptional communication skills, with the ability to collaborate with both technical and non-technical stakeholders.

  • Certifications in relevant cloud platforms, data technologies and AI platforms & frameworks

  • Experience with Infrastructure as Code: Terraform, CloudFormation, or ARM templates

  • Experience with knowledge graph technologies, ontology design, and semantic modelling with experience with graph databases (e.g., Neo4j, Neptune, etc.) and query languages (e.g., Cypher, SPARQL)

  • Experience with containerization (Docker, Kubernetes) and infrastructure as code

  • Experience designing and implementing autonomous agent systems and multi-agent architectures

  • Hands on experience with retrieval-augmented generation (RAG) systems and vector databases

  • Experience with agent frameworks such as LangChain, AutoGPT, or custom agent implementations

  • Familiarity with large language model (LLM) orchestration and optimization

  • Knowledge of real-time data processing frameworks, data mesh architecture and domain-driven design

  • Experience with prompt engineering and AI agent behaviour design
